Thermo-Bonding Oven mod. RP251
Technical features of the machine
- Working width:
- up to 4000mm
- Roll face width:
- Working width + 200mm
- Material fibres:
- nonwoven web of polyester or different fibres mixed with 10-25% polyester bi-component binder fibres or different binder fibres
- Speed:
- 1 - 20 mt/min. (other upon request)
- Distance between belts:
- 5÷195mm
- Heating media:
- electrical/gas/gas oil
- Heating capacity installed:
- 300.000 Kcal/h (two sections in working width 2500 mm)
- Circulating air volume:
- 2 x max. 35.000m³/h, adjustable by frequency converter (for working width 2500mm)
- Maximum air temperature:
- 20÷230 °C
- Compressed air requirements :
- 7 bar
- Installed power:
- Approx. 60 kw (for two sections)
- Approx. Weight:
- According to the working width of the machine
Description
The thermo-bonding Oven is a stable, welded construction, made out of sectional steel. It is realized by modular sections of 2 metres each one.
The walls have a thickness of 100 mm and are insulated with special material (rock wool).
Thanks to the modular design of the system, additional heating or cooling sections can be added later for increasing the capacity.
Each heating section is equipped with its own ventilation , temperature control and air filtering system.
The material to be processed is contained between two belts especially designed with open mesh for high air permeability. The distance of the belt and blowing nozzles can be individually adjusted in each section of the Oven.
By a particular nozzles disposition, an high and uniform hot air flow is obtained between the two sides of the material. This effect can be noticed in a short heating up period and in a high bulk of the product.
At the exit point of the Oven, a cooling zone is mounted. The air is sucked through the material when said material is still contained between the two transport .belts.
The speed of the corresponding fan is adjusted by Inverter.
